Middleton HS Electrathon Rally December 11, 2021

On Saturday, December 11th, we held our STEM Electrathon Rally at Middleton High School in Tampa. We thank Middleton HS Electrathon Sponsor William Knight, his Team and Administration for hosting our event. It has been quite a few years since we held a race at Middleton. They have an awesome parking lot that has turns and some changes in track evaluation. Mulberry Sponsor Todd Thuma brought out his distance measuring wheel and found the track to be 2,075 feet or .393 tenths of a mile.

We had two new cars on the track for this race. Middleton HS brought out their new car that they finished the week of the race.Jim Robinson (Silver Bullet Racing) brought out his new car that was built in the past month to run in the Advanced Battery Class.

We had 11 cars line up for the first race.

Race Steward Mike Frederick waived the green flag, and they were off for the first hour of competition. The first race proved to be challenging for our teams. The Kinetic Industries car 99 had chain and tire issues along with new batteries that developed dead cells. Plant City HS car 208 had the weld on their mirrors let go, dropping them onto the track. Tiger Racing, car 4 experienced more of a draw on one battery. Silver Bullets new car had its fill of chain issue’s. Mulberry car 38 had chain and tire issues. Plant City car 210 had issues with the rear wheel axle.

The total laps from both races were combined to determine the final results for the day.
High School Class
1st Place Plant City car 210 with 94 laps
2nd Place Middleton car 80 with 81 laps
3rd Place Plant City car 208 with 52 laps
4th Place Plant City car 83 with 52 laps
5th Place Mulberry car 38 with 33 laps
Open Class
1st Place Silver Bullet car 94 with 102 laps
2nd Place Tiger Racing car 4 with 101 laps
3rd Place Kinetic Ind. car 19 with 82 laps
4th Place Kinetic Ind. car 99 with 20 laps
Advanced Battery Class
1st Place Fortuna car 444 with 94 laps
2nd Place Silver Bullet car 13 with 21 laps
